The tiny village of Gourdon is perched high on a mountain with spectacular views of the coastline and sea beyond, as well as of the Loup River Valley. With a population of approximately 400 it receives over a million visitors a year - a 4-lane divided highway climbs to the village from the west (Grasse) approach allowing for easy access for tour busses and all sorts of cars.It is about 35 km from Nice. Not only crowded, it is also expensive both at the restaurants and at the craft, clothing, and jewelry stores which line its streets. One cannot question the scenic position and quaint appearance - the beauty of the trip in from the east - up the Loup River Gorge - will make your day.

Gourdon has a long history, like all the medieval hill villages. With its strategic position, it was occupied by the Romans. The castle and adjacent gardens date from the 9th Century. Queen Victoria visited - the square that overlooks the coastal panorama is named in her honor.
